CD7-specific CAR-T Cell in the Treatment of CD7-positive Relapsed/Refractory Hematologic Tumors
An Open-label Clinical Study on the Efficacy and Safety of CD7-specific CAR-T Cell Injection in the Treatment of CD7-positive Relapsed/Refractory Hematologic Tumors

Summary
This study is a single-center, open, prospective single-arm clinical study of patients with CD7 postive relapsed / refractoryhematological tumors to evaluate the safety and efficacy of CD7-specific CAR-T cells in relapsed / refractory hematological tumors while collecting pharmacokinetics and pharmacodynamics indicators of CAR-T cells.
Detailed description
In order to study CD7-targeting CAR-T cell therapy, we constructed a lentiviral CAR structure. The CD7-targeting fragment was cloned into a second-generation CAR structural backbone with 4-1BB and CD3E. Since endogenous CD7 in T cells causes CD7-targeting CAR-T cells to kill each other, we used a natural selection method to prepare CD7-targeting CAR (CD7-CART) T cells that do not express the CD7 protein (CD7-).

Interventions
| Type | Name | Description |
|---|---|---|
| DRUG | Fludarabine + Cyclophosphamide + CD7-specific CAR-T Cells | fludarabine 30 mg/kg on day -5, -4, and -3; cyclophosphamide 300 mg/kg on day -5, -4, and -3; CD7-specific CAR-T Cells on day 0. |
